Delphi10.3的SpeedButton/BitBtn学习

Delphi10.3的SpeedButton/BitBtn学习

原创

暖流中的鱼 ©著作权

文章标签 Delphi教程 Delphi学习 文章分类 后端开发

©著作权归作者所有:来自51CTO博客作者暖流中的鱼的原创作品,请联系作者获取转载授权,否则将追究法律责任

1】SpeedButton/BitBtn的图片Glyph属性

2】文字Caption属性的设定

3】图片文字位置Layout的设定

4】SpeedButton按下和弹起效果

5】SpeedButton的其他 属性说明

6】BitBtn控件与SpeedButton类似,只是多了可以获得焦点


 1】SpeedButton的图片Glyph属性, 只能是BMP格式,且不能为纯色。

Delphi10.3的SpeedButton/BitBtn学习_Delphi学习


 2】文字Caption属性的设定

Delphi10.3的SpeedButton/BitBtn学习_Delphi教程_02


3】图片文字位置Layout的设定

Delphi10.3的SpeedButton/BitBtn学习_Delphi教程_03


4】SpeedButton按下和弹起效果

想达到这样的效果:
点击一下TSpeedButton按钮,按钮凹下去,再点击一下,按钮弹起恢复。

实现方法:
只要设置下述2个属性即可,不需要编码:
①AllowAllUp = True
②Groupldex属性:该属性默认值为0,表示不与其他 Speed Button成组, 若同一组(Groupldex属性相同),只允许一个SpeedButton按下(Down属性为True).

 Delphi10.3的SpeedButton/BitBtn学习_Delphi学习_04


5】SpeedButton的其他 属性说明

(1)Down属性:设置按钮是否处于按下状态。
(2)Flat属性:当取值为True时,按钮具有Office97工具栏的扁平风格。默认值为 False。 


6】BitBtn控件与SpeedButton类似,

只是多了可以获得焦点,但没有Groupldex属性

 
 
 
 
 
 
  • 收藏
  • 评论
  • 举报
提问和评论都可以,用心的回复会被更多人看到 评论
发布评论
相关文章

举报文章

请选择举报类型

内容侵权 涉嫌营销 内容抄袭 违法信息 其他

具体原因

包含不真实信息 涉及个人隐私

补充说明

0/200

上传截图

格式支持JPEG/PNG/JPG,图片不超过1.9M

已经收到您得举报信息,我们会尽快审核